Ramona D. Marquardt, age 88, formerly of Nickerson, Died Friday January 31, 2020 at the Hooper Care Center Ramona was born April 20, 1931 in Ord, Nebraska to Fred and Gladys 'Flock' Miska.

She lived in Ord until her family moved to Washington, Nebraska. She graduated from Elkhorn High School, then attended Wayne State College and received her teaching certificate. She taught at March School near Kennard. She also worked for Mutual of Omaha and finally at the Post Office in Nickerson. Ramona married Quentin Marquardt in 1957 and they farmed near Nickerson. She enjoyed sewing, traveling and square dancing. She was a member of the Flying Farmers and was a Queen of the Nebraska Chapter, and a member of Redeemer Lutheran Church in Hooper. She was preceded in death by Quentin on March 7, 2018.
